At least 15 people have died when a plane on a short internal flight crashed after take-off at Lagos airport in Nigeria. The Associated Airlines Embraer 120 was flying from the country’s commercial capital to Akure, a town about 140 miles to the southwest. Air crashes are relatively common in Nigeria, which has a poor safety record. Last year, 163 people died when a plane hit an apartment block in Lagos in the country’s worst airline disaster in twenty years. Report by Jeremy Barnes.
